It is a fact that Internet Marketers use "dirty tricks" to sell their products and services. Although many of them won't admit to the fact. Still, it's the truth! Some of them may not even realize they're using them. And some of them do know. The latter half are the folks that are raking in the cash daily. What is a "dirty trick"? Well, that's easy. It is a sly method used by people every day to get a desired reaction out of another person. When you think of these words, you may think "rip-off", "unethical", or "illegal". Let's get one thing straight right away. The tactics discussed in this book are not illegal. They are not unethical and they are not a rip-off. But they are a bit on the "crafty" side. Crafty or not, the point is they work. And if you're not using them, then you're losing money.
